Roles and Responsibilities of Immigration Lawyers

Immigration lawyers serve as vital advocates for individuals and families navigating the complex landscape of immigration law. Their responsibilities include guiding clients through visa applications, representing them in asylum claims, and defending against deportation proceedings. These legal professionals not only ensure that their clients understand the requirements and timelines involved in their cases, but they also prepare and submit the necessary documentation to government agencies. The Importance of Legal Representation

Legal representation is crucial in immigration cases, as small errors or misunderstandings can lead to significant consequences, including delays or denials. An experienced immigration lawyer not only helps clients comprehend the intricate laws and regulations but also acts as a buffer between them and sometimes intimidating legal proceedings. The personal nature of immigration issues often makes this support indispensable, especially for clients facing the potential for separation from loved ones or uncertainty about their future in a new country.
